Photo Station Photostation funktioniert nicht --> Keine Ahnung wieso...

Status
Für weitere Antworten geschlossen.

roessrob

Benutzer
Mitglied seit
10. Jul 2013
Beiträge
30
Punkte für Reaktionen
0
Punkte
0
Hallo Community,

meine Photostation geht leider "auf einmal" nicht mehr. Ich bekomme eine äußerst komische Fehlermeldung. Ich habe bereits versucht, diese neuzuinstallieren und das System habe ich auch mehrmal rebootet...

Kann mir jemand bitte helfen?

Danke und Grüße,
roessrob

screen.jpg

Hmmm ich habe die Photostation gerade nochmals aufgerufen.... jetzt erscheint folgender Fehler... was bedeutet das nun schon wieder?!

screen1.JPG

Oh man... irgendwas stimmt mit meinem NAS nicht, ich bin versuchsweise auf die DSM-Aktualisierung gegangen. Diese gibt mir eine Fehlermeldung zurück, dass nicht genug Speicherplatz vorhanden ist... aber das stimmt nicht.
Ich hab das dumpfe Gefühl, dass etwas mit den Privilegien nicht stimmt, aber wie bekomme ich das wieder in Ordnung?
 
Zuletzt bearbeitet:

nachon

Benutzer
Mitglied seit
21. Aug 2011
Beiträge
2.666
Punkte für Reaktionen
9
Punkte
78
Ich kann aufgrund der Größe des Bildes die Fehlermeldung leider nicht lesen.

Und was heisst "auf einmal"? Hast Du denn etwas getan? Versucht zu aktualisieren z.B.?
 

roessrob

Benutzer
Mitglied seit
10. Jul 2013
Beiträge
30
Punkte für Reaktionen
0
Punkte
0
Hi hier nochmal nur der Text --> dieser kommt aber NUR, wenn ich aus dem DSM die Photostation starte (mit einem User in der URL)


Rich (BBCode):
Warning  date() [<a href='function.date'>function.date</a>]: It is not safe to rely on the system's timezone settings. You are *required* to use the date.timezone setting or the date_default_timezone_set() function. In case you used any of those methods and you are still getting this warning, you most likely misspelled the timezone identifier. We selected 'Europe/Berlin' for 'CEST/2.0/DST' instead in /volume1/@appstore/PhotoStation/photo/include/photo/synophoto_csPhotoDB.php on line 2483

Warning:  Cannot modify header information - headers already sent by (output started at /volume1/@appstore/PhotoStation/photo/include/photo/synophoto_csPhotoDB.php:2483) in /volume1/@appstore/PhotoStation/photo/login.php on line 17

Warning:  Cannot modify header information - headers already sent by (output started at /volume1/@appstore/PhotoStation/photo/include/photo/synophoto_csPhotoDB.php:2483) in /volume1/@appstore/PhotoStation/photo/login.php on line 18

Warning:  Cannot modify header information - headers already sent by (output started at /volume1/@appstore/PhotoStation/photo/include/photo/synophoto_csPhotoDB.php:2483) in /volume1/@appstore/PhotoStation/photo/login.php on line 24

Warning:  Cannot modify header information - headers already sent by (output started at /volume1/@appstore/PhotoStation/photo/include/photo/synophoto_csPhotoDB.php:2483) in /volume1/@appstore/PhotoStation/photo/login.php</b> on line 25

Warning:  Unknown: write failed: No space left on device (28) inUnknown on line 0

Warning:  Unknown: Failed to write session data (files). Please verify that the current setting of session.save_path is correct () in Unknown on line 0

Komische Sache....

Also nochmal....

Ich war ein paar Tage weg und das NAS war einfach nur ausgeschaltet.... es wurde nichts verändert. Aber irgendwas scheint wohl schief gelaufen zu sein. Beim Neuinstallieren musste ich den "Vereinbarungen" zustimmen und einige Apps wurden aktualisiert. Es fühlt sich so an, als wäre der "admin"-User mit dem ich anmelde "neu", bzw. als wäre es teilweise neu aufgesetzt. Es ist schwierig zu beschreiben.... andere Dinge funktionieren einwandfrei (mumble-server, pyLoad, Video-Station, svn-Server, Tomvcat, etc), nur scheint trotzdem etwas nicht ganz okay zu sein....
 
Zuletzt bearbeitet:

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.174
Punkte für Reaktionen
423
Punkte
393
Hallo,
Deine Systempartition scheint voll zu sein. Verbinde Dich per ssh mit der DS (user:root, password:das vom admin) und poste mal die Ausgabe von
df

Gruß Götz
 

roessrob

Benutzer
Mitglied seit
10. Jul 2013
Beiträge
30
Punkte für Reaktionen
0
Punkte
0
Danke für den Tipp.... die Partition ist aber nie und nimmer voll.... es sind noch mindestens 6TB frei....

Hier die Ausgabe, wobei ich jetzt auch sehe, dass das "NAS" denkt, es ist alles voll.... wie kommt das?

df
Filesystem 1K-blocks Used Available Use% Mounted on
rootfs 2451064 2402504 0 100% /
/dev/root 2451064 2402504 0 100% /
/tmp 257464 784 256680 1% /tmp
/dev/md2 7682125284 2333279224 5348743660 31% /volume1
/dev/md2 7682125284 2333279224 5348743660 31% /opt

Ich hab weiterhin etwas rumgespielt. Ich hatte mal die WebStation, PHP und mySQL aktiviert, weil ich diese Dienste demnächst nutzen will. Es gibt eine Checkbox "open_base_dir".... diesen habe ich mal weggehakt... Jetzt bekomme ich folgende Fehlermeldung beim Aufruf der Photostation:

Fatal error: Uncaught exception 'Exception' with message 'Facebook needs the CURL PHP extension.' in /volume1/@appstore/PhotoStation/photo/facebook/php-sdk/src/base_facebook.php:19 Stack trace: #0 /volume1/@appstore/PhotoStation/photo/facebook/php-sdk/src/facebook.php(18): require_once() #1 /volume1/@appstore/PhotoStation/photo/include/photo/synophoto_csPhotoMisc.php(4): require_once('/volume1/@appst...') #2 /volume1/@appstore/PhotoStation/photo/include/syno_conf.php(282): require_once('/volume1/@appst...') #3 /volume1/@appstore/PhotoStation/photo/login.php(2): require_once('/volume1/@appst...') #4 {main} thrown in /volume1/@appstore/PhotoStation/photo/facebook/php-sdk/src/base_facebook.php on line 19

Ich bin ein wenig ratlos, was ist denn eigentlich kaputt?
 
Zuletzt bearbeitet:

Thorndike

Benutzer
Mitglied seit
22. Sep 2010
Beiträge
742
Punkte für Reaktionen
4
Punkte
38
Wie die ursprüngliche Meldung bereits sagt ist die Platte voll! Das zeigt auch die Meldung

rootfs 2451064 2402504 0 100% /

Dein Rootverzeichnis ist zu 100% belegt. Keine Ahnung was er da jetzt speziell reinschreiben will aber da ist z.B. /var/log/messages drin. Eventuell funktioniert etwas nicht richtig und er hat dir alles zugelogged. Wenn du genau wissen möchtes was den ganzen Platz verbraucht wirst du wohl alles untersuchen müssen was nicht in den anderen Mountpunkten

/tmp 257464 784 256680 1% /tmp
/dev/md2 7682125284 2333279224 5348743660 31% /volume1
/dev/md2 7682125284 2333279224 5348743660 31% /opt

liegt. Dabei hilft dir sicherlich der Befehl du wie diskusage. Die genauen Parameter findest z.B. hier: http://linux.about.com/library/cmd/blcmdl1_du.htm
Die Synology Implementierung kann eventuell den einen oder anderen Parameter nicht aber das meiste sollte gehen.
 

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.174
Punkte für Reaktionen
423
Punkte
393
Hallo,
lass open_base_dir drinnen sonst funktioniert die Photostation nicht.
Das Problem ist die Systempartition (die Daten liegen auf der Datenpartition und da hast Du Platz)
/dev/root 2451064 2402504 0 100% /
100% voll, 2,4GB von 2,4GB belegt!
Poste bitte mal die Ausgabe von
du -d 1 -x /

Gruß Götz
 

roessrob

Benutzer
Mitglied seit
10. Jul 2013
Beiträge
30
Punkte für Reaktionen
0
Punkte
0
Hi,
ok "open_base_dir" habe ich wieder angehakt, aber das Ergebnis ist gleich. Die Systempartition? Ich dachte, das System wäre auf den Platten drauf? Wenn das nicht der Fall ist, wäre das natürlich sehr komisch. Wie auch immer, muss ich da natürlich wieder Platz schaffen, aber wie?

du -d 1 -x / geht leider nicht, ich habe mal du --help gemacht, welche Option meinst du?

du --help
Usage: du [OPTION]... [FILE]...
or: du [OPTION]... --files0-from=F
Summarize disk usage of each FILE, recursively for directories.

Mandatory arguments to long options are mandatory for short options too.
-a, --all write counts for all files, not just directories
--apparent-size print apparent sizes, rather than disk usage; although
the apparent size is usually smaller, it may be
larger due to holes in (`sparse') files, internal
fragmentation, indirect blocks, and the like
-B, --block-size=SIZE use SIZE-byte blocks
-b, --bytes equivalent to `--apparent-size --block-size=1'
-c, --total produce a grand total
-D, --dereference-args dereference only symlinks that are listed on the
command line
--files0-from=F summarize disk usage of the NUL-terminated file
names specified in file F;
If F is - then read names from standard input
-H equivalent to --dereference-args (-D)
-h, --human-readable print sizes in human readable format (e.g., 1K 234M 2G)
--si like -h, but use powers of 1000 not 1024
-k like --block-size=1K
-l, --count-links count sizes many times if hard linked
-m like --block-size=1M
-L, --dereference dereference all symbolic links
-P, --no-dereference don't follow any symbolic links (this is the default)
-0, --null end each output line with 0 byte rather than newline
-S, --separate-dirs do not include size of subdirectories
-s, --summarize display only a total for each argument
-x, --one-file-system skip directories on different file systems
-X, --exclude-from=FILE exclude files that match any pattern in FILE
--exclude=PATTERN exclude files that match PATTERN
--max-depth=N print the total for a directory (or file, with --all)
only if it is N or fewer levels below the command
line argument; --max-depth=0 is the same as
--summarize
--time show time of the last modification of any file in the
directory, or any of its subdirectories
--time=WORD show time as WORD instead of modification time:
atime, access, use, ctime or status
--time-style=STYLE show times using style STYLE:
full-iso, long-iso, iso, +FORMAT
FORMAT is interpreted like `date'
--help display this help and exit
--version output version information and exit

Display values are in units of the first available SIZE from --block-size,
and the DU_BLOCK_SIZE, BLOCK_SIZE and BLOCKSIZE environment variables.
Otherwise, units default to 1024 bytes (or 512 if POSIXLY_CORRECT is set).

SIZE may be (or may be an integer optionally followed by) one of following:
KB 1000, K 1024, MB 1000*1000, M 1024*1024, and so on for G, T, P, E, Z, Y.

Report du bugs to bug-coreutils@gnu.org
GNU coreutils home page: <http://www.gnu.org/software/coreutils/>
General help using GNU software: <http://www.gnu.org/gethelp/>
For complete documentation, run: info coreutils 'du invocation'
 

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.174
Punkte für Reaktionen
423
Punkte
393
Hallo,
bei der du Version muß es
du -x --max-depth=1 /
heißen.

Gruß Götz

PS hast Du ipkg installiert? was sagt
which du
 

roessrob

Benutzer
Mitglied seit
10. Jul 2013
Beiträge
30
Punkte für Reaktionen
0
Punkte
0
Hi,

also der Output des erste Befehls lautet:

du -x --max-depth=1 /
0 /tmp
2100 /bin
84 /dev
3812 /etc
1869584 /volumeUSB1
4 /.old_patch_info
3540 /etc.defaults
4 /initrd
8664 /.syno
4 /opt
4 /volumeUSB2
106820 /lib
16 /.system_info
28 /home
4 /lost+found
4 /mnt
0 /proc
80 /root
5448 /sbin
0 /sys
317336 /usr
15796 /var
60 /var.defaults
4 /volume1
2333404 /

which du gibt folgendes aus:

which du
/opt/bin/du

Was kann ich tun, bzw. was sagt mir die oben stehende Information?
 

goetz

Super-Moderator
Teammitglied
Sehr erfahren
Mitglied seit
18. Mrz 2009
Beiträge
14.174
Punkte für Reaktionen
423
Punkte
393
Hallo,
1869584 /volumeUSB1
in dem Verzeichnis sind 1,8GB drin und sollte aber eigentlich nur ein Mountpoint für USB Massenspeicher sein. Schau Dir den Inhalt (ohne angesteckten USB Massenspeicher) mal genauer an (evtl. mc per ipkg installieren).

Gruß Götz
 

roessrob

Benutzer
Mitglied seit
10. Jul 2013
Beiträge
30
Punkte für Reaktionen
0
Punkte
0
Wow irre.... da waren alte unnoetige Daten enthalten... die habe ich gelöscht und jetzt kommt nicht, das Problem mit der DSM-Aktualisierung...

Es ist eine Aktualisierung da, ich werde diese mal installieren...

Wie kann es sein, dass dort diese Dateien gelandet sind?

Photostation geht leider noch immer nicht :/

Danke und Gruesse
 

Thorndike

Benutzer
Mitglied seit
22. Sep 2010
Beiträge
742
Punkte für Reaktionen
4
Punkte
38
Wenn du einen USB Speicher einsteckst wird durch den automount ein Verzeichnis erzeugt auf das der Speicher gemountet wird. Ist der Speicher nicht mehr vorhanden gibt es das Verzeichnis weiterhin und man kann dort ganz normal im Dateisystem speichern. Damit kann man noch viel witzigere Fehler produzieren. Im Normalfall sollte auf das Verzeichnis auch nur ROOT Zugriff haben aber wenn man eben alles als admin macht gilt auch hier: Ich bin "Root", ich darf das und weiß was ich mache. So ist Linux eben.
 

roessrob

Benutzer
Mitglied seit
10. Jul 2013
Beiträge
30
Punkte für Reaktionen
0
Punkte
0
Ja das ist sehr komisch das Ganze... na auf jedenfall klappt jetzt wieder alles. Ich habe die Daten gelöscht, das DSM aktualisiert und nun läuft alles. Vielen Dank euch nochmals :)
 
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at